What to do if dahlia leaves turn yellow

1. Replace the potting soil:

Reason: Inappropriate potting soil can easily cause its leaves to turn yellow. Dahlias are suitable for growing in loose and well-drained soil. If heavy clay soil is used, it will not only cause the leaves to turn yellow, but also be detrimental to its growth.

Solution: You can replace it with suitable soil, which will not only help improve the yellow leaves, but also be of great benefit to its growth and development.

2. Apply fertilizer appropriately:

Reason: Some people apply a lot of fertilizer to make it grow faster, which can easily lead to yellow leaves or even withering and rotting.

Solution: First, remove the yellow leaves, then water it thoroughly and place it under the sun. When applying fertilizer, be moderate and do not apply too much or too frequently.

3. Reasonable light control:

Reason: Dahlias like sunlight. If they are exposed to excessive sunlight during the growing period or do not receive enough sunlight, their leaves will turn yellow.

Solution: Place it in a sunny place without being overwhelmed by the sun. If the sunlight is very strong, move it to another place.

4. Water appropriately:

Reason: Dahlias are afraid of waterlogging and are not drought-tolerant. Excessive watering or lack of water will cause the leaves to turn yellow.

Solution: When watering it, you should wait until the soil is completely dry and then water it thoroughly. If there is water in the pot after rain, drain it out in time.
